I’d be very surprised if wodhooh goes stayers myself
Gordon has only had one winner in each of the last 2 festivals so she’ll go for the easiest race.
Could be the stayers but the mares without Lossie looks far easier as it stands right now.
 
I’d be very surprised if wodhooh goes stayers myself
I think that's the obvious conclusion and the markets pretty much reflect that, but you have to say Teahupoo is probably regressing so he won't have an obvious Stayers horse, they'll probably look to swerve Lossie if she gets to Champion Hurdle fit so Brighterdaysahead to the Mares would look an obvious switch which could then push Wodhooh to the Stayers.
I'm not sure which would be a tougher race, level weights against the girls or getting 7lb against the boys at a trip I think she'll improve further for.
20/1 doesn't scream massive value but if all that plays out I think she'd be fav on the day so could be a nice trading voucher...
